I've been thinking about buying my first handgun (a sig p229) and I've been shopping around both local stores and out-of-state dealers. I'm trying to figure out how to compare the prices from each so that things are on an apples-to-apples basis. I've had trouble finding dealers out-of-state that stock the guns with 10-rd magazines so they usually have to exclude them for a tiny discount. Suppose the following:
Out-of-state:
$720 shipped, excluding hi-cap mags
+$100 DROS/transfer
+8.5% sales tax
=$890 final gun price, then +$70 for two factory 10rd mags ordered online
=$960 total package
In-state
$825 including two 10-rd mags
+$25 DROS
+8.5% sales tax
=$922 total package
Is this correct/reasonable? Did I take care of everything? With the high fees in the Bay Area it's hard to find a deal out-of-state that seems to make sense. Would you guys agree? Any comments appreciated. Thanks in advance!
